	Astdb was determined to be one of the most significant bottlenecks in SIP registration processing. This patch improved the speed of an astdb load test by 50000% (yes, Fifty-Thousand Percent). On this particular load test setup, this doubled the number of SIP registrations the server could handle. | /*!
 | |
|  * \internal
 | |
|  * \brief astdb sync thread
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* This thread is in charge of syncing astdb to disk after a change.
 | |
|  * By pushing it off to this thread to take care of, this I/O bound operation
 | |
|  * will not block other threads from performing other critical processing.
 | |
|  * If changes happen rapidly, this thread will also ensure that the sync
 | |
|  * operations are rate limited.
 | |
|  */
 | |
| static void *db_sync_thread(void *data)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	ast_mutex_lock(&dblock);
 | |
| 	for (;;) {
 | |
| 		ast_cond_wait(&dbcond, &dblock);
 | |
| 		ast_mutex_unlock(&dblock);
 | |
| 		sleep(1);
 | |
| 		ast_mutex_lock(&dblock);
 | |
| 		astdb->sync(astdb, 0);
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	return NULL;
 | |
| }
